We are thrilled to announce that Reverend Edith A. Love has joined UUFBR as our new Contract Minister! Rev. Edith, who lives in Memphis, TN with her daughter, will be combining onsite and remote ministry on a ¾-time basis for UUFBR. She is also the quarter-time Pastor for the UU Congregation in Tupelo, Mississippi. Please give her a warm UUFBR welcome – and if you’re interested in helping plan our formal installation and welcome brunch later in February, please let the co-presidents Rajeev and Claire know ASAP. How fortunate are we: with a newly articulated focus on Love as the center of our UU faith, we get to welcome Rev. Edith Love to our Fellowship!

Empower, Enlighten, and Energize Fair – A Holistic Healing and Metaphysical Event
Join us for the inaugural Empower, Enlighten, and Energize Fair—a vibrant celebration of holistic healing, metaphysical wisdom, and spiritual community, hosted at the beautiful Unitarian Universalist Fellowship of Boca Raton. Beginning at 4:00 PM on Saturday August 9th, explore a marketplace filled with unique metaphysical vendors offering crystals, handmade goods, smudging tools, and sacred items. Enjoy a variety of
interactive experiences including psychic readings, tarot, palmistry, and tea leaf readings. Engage with local holistic healers offering reiki, sound healing, and spiritual guidance.
Don’t miss our rotating schedule of enlightening workshops and engaging speakers on goddess spirituality, energy balancing, and conscious living. Treat yourself to soothing herbal teas and delightful fairy cakes in our enchanted café corner. The evening culminates in a magical Full Moon Drum Circle on the labyrinth at sunset—a grounding and energizing communal ritual under the moonlight.
Admission is free! Services, merchandise, and food available for purchase. All are welcome—bring your open heart and curious spirit.

Healing Justice
Healing Justice Blog[/button] Healing Justice is a small group that works together to counter racism wherever it occurs. We recognize that racism is complex and exists at all levels, from individual to societal. Action taken recently includes education for our own congregation about why we are considering incorporating a proposed 8th Principle. More direct recent action includes supporting UU the Vote as a precursor to upending structural racism in our nation. Healing Justice meets on the 4th Tuesday of each month, except for November 2024, when it will meet on November 19th.
